Our camp philosophy is based on safe sports participation. We teach the same skills every week. However the priority is to learn skills through playing the actual sports with games and modified games/drills. Skills are taught in tennis and basketball. The younger participants will retain little of the skills , the older ones will retain more. Our camp stresses participation in the sports activities. Soccer involves games only. Fitness related low organization games will also be used minimally. | ||
TENNIS BASICS | TENNIS INTERMEDIATES | |
Mo |
FOREHAND/BACKHAND (every day) 1-2 hands, grip, ready position, backswing, forward swing (low to high), follow through DRILLS- shake hands, other hand above, hit ball down, up, off 1 bounce, vs coach, vs wall, baseball tennis Races |
FOREHAND/BACKHAND (every day) topspin, slice, sidespin - 1-2 hands, grip, ready position, backswing, forward swing (low to high), follow through DRILLS - vs coach ¼ ½ ¾ full court, down line/cross court, Royal court, round about, |
Tu |
SERVE - Underhand, overhead, grip, ready position, backswing/ball toss, forward swing, follow through | SERVE - topspin/kick, slice - grip, ready position, backswing/ball toss, forward swing, follow through |
We |
VOLLEY - grip, backswing (short), punch/block DRILLS – vs coach, vs wall |
LOB, OVERHEAD Lob (topspin/slice) Overhead (turn sideways, FS, FT) |
Th | SINGLES STRATEGY – Score love,15,30,40,game, Keep ball in play, hit deep | SINGLES TOURNAMENT hit side to side and front to back |
Fr | DOUBLES STRATEGY- Keep ball in play, side/side | DOUBLES TOURNAMENT- Rush the net, hit deep/lob |
BASKETBALL BASICS | BASKETBALL INTERMEDIATES | |
Mo |
BALLHANDLING/SHOOTING (every day) BH- finger tips spread, pump motion BH DR- off floor, on floor, both hands, crossover, fig 8s, individual tag, team tag, 7 up tag, bulldog SH – Set shot-Ball on finger tips (not palm), on 1 hand only, under ball, elbow down F Lay up- jump stop, 2 step 2 hands overhand/finger roll DRILLS- lay up/shot both sides, 21, bump, 21 on the ball |
BALLHANDLING/SHOOTING (every day) |
Tu |
PIVOT/TRIPLE THREAT/SQUARE UP create space/pivot, right/left pocket, pivot forward/backward, butt down, space/balancc |
PIVOT/TRIPPLE THREAT/SQUARE UP attack basket from pivots DEF- 2/2 sag off to ball and recover, deny |
We |
PASSING/RECEIVING Passing- bounce/chest Holding ball, FT-thumbs down, Receiving- thumbs together, create target DRILLS- vs wall, with partner |
PASSING/RECEIVING Passing- baseball, one hand off dribble Receiving- 1 hand catch DEF- 3/3 on ball stay rimball others ag or deny |
Th | FAKING, GIVE/GO Fake shot/pass/dribble- believable |
FAKING, PICK AWAY DEF- 4/4 rimball on ball, 1 pass away deny 2 passes sag |
Fr |
REB - Jump to get ball come down elbows out REB DRILL – Off wall to self to lay up DEF – close out on shot, 1/1 stay between rim/ball DEF DRILL sprint turn at foul line slow backwards |
FASTBREAK- 1 player straight to basket, 2 even lanes, 3 odd lanes, 4 trailor, 5 safety DRILLS- 1/0, 2/0, 3/0, 4/0, 5/0, 2/1, 3/2 DEF- 4/4 rimball on ball, 1 pass away deny 2 passes sag |
